/*
 * @bug 4070080
 *
 * @build WriteAddedSuperClass ReadAddedSuperClass2
 * @run main ReadAddedSuperClass2
 * @summary  2nd part of test deserializes the serialization stream into an
 *           instance of the original class WHEN the AddedSuperClass exists
 *           locally.
 *
 * Description of failure:
 *
 * If you delete AddedSuperClass.class before running this test,
 * both JDK 1.1.x and 1.2 result in ClassNotFoundException for class
 * AddedSuperClass.  If the .class file is not deleted, 1.2 does not
 * fail. However, JDK 1.1.4 core dumps dereferencing a null class handle
 * in the native method for inputClassDescriptor.
 */

import java.io.*;

class AddedSuperClass implements Serializable {
    private static final long serialVersionUID = 1L;

    // Needed at least one field to recreate failure.
    int field;
}

class A implements Serializable {
    // Version 1.0 of class A.
    private static final long serialVersionUID = 1L;
}

public class ReadAddedSuperClass2 {
    public static void main(String args[]) throws IOException, ClassNotFoundException {
        File f = new File("tmp.ser");
        ObjectInput in =
            new ObjectInputStream(new FileInputStream(f));
        A a = (A)in.readObject();
        in.close();
    }
}
